Saint Louis' Ream invited to MLS combine
Updated: December 11, 2009
ST. LOUIS – St. Louis(m) senior defender Tim Ream (St. Louis, Mo./St. Dominic) has been invited to participate in the 2010 adidas MLS Player Combine. The annual player combine will be held at Central Broward Regional Park in Ft. Lauderdale, Fla., Jan. 8-12, 2010.
The coaching and management staffs of all 16 MLS teams will be in attendance to scout talent at the 2010 adidas MLS Player Combine. The 2010 MLS SuperDraft will be held Thursday, Jan. 14, 2010, in Philadelphia.
The 2009 Atlantic 10 Conference Defensive Player of the Year, Ream started all 22 games for the Billikens this season and contributed a career-high 17 points (6G, 5A) to rank second on the team. He notched two game winners, including a memorable tally late in the A-10 semifinal matchup against Rhode Island that vaulted the Billikens into the A-10 Championship title game.
Ream played in all but one game during his four-year Billiken career, totaling 82 games played and 68 starts. He ended his career with 24 career points (6G, 12A). He was named first-team All-Region (NSCAA) and second-team All-Conference his sophomore and junior seasons.
This marks the fifth straight season that at least one Billiken has been invited to the player combine. Currently, there are seven former Billikens active in MLS. They are Brandon Barklage (DC United), Brad Davis (Houston Dynamo), John DiRaimondo (DC United), Jack Jewsbury (KC Wizards), Brian McBride (Chicago Fire), Kyle Patterson (LA Galaxy) and Tim Ward (Chicago Fire).
